Introduction to mathematical programming pdf

This book is a first step to addressing these difficulties,providing a broad introduction to the key methods and underlyingconcepts of mathematical models in ecology and evolution. Pdf introduction to mathematical programming semantic. Unlike static pdf introduction to mathematical programming solution manuals or printed answer keys, our experts show you how to solve each problem stepbystep. Why is chegg study better than downloaded introduction to mathematical programming pdf solution manuals.

Also, these problems can be solved by an algorithm that can be implemented on a computer, so linear programming is a widely used practical tool. Walker, introduction to mathematical programming pearson.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. We strongly recommend this book to anyone interested in a very readable presentation, replete with examples and references. The second is theampl modeling language, which we designed and implemented to help people use computers to develop and apply mathematical programming models. Pdf introduction to mathematical programming semantic scholar. Chapter 9 introduction to dynamic programming section 9. Unlike static pdf introduction to mathematical programming 4th edition solution manuals or printed answer keys, our experts show you how to solve each problem stepbystep. No need to wait for office hours or assignments to be graded to find out where you took a wrong turn. Mathematical programming lixpolytechnique ecole polytechnique. Pdf introduction to mathematical modelling download full. Introduction to mathematical programming operations research vol. An introduction to mathematical optimal control theory version 0.

Volume oneisbn 0534359647 includes chapters 1 through 10, 11, and 14 of. Introduction to mathematical programming oper ations research. We do not assume the reader has had a course in real analysis. Mathematical logic, important in formal methods of software development and in arti. A subset of winstons bestselling operations research, introduction to mathematical programming offers selfcontained chapters that make it flexible enough for one or twosemester courses ranging from advanced beginning to intermediate in level. Pdf introduction to mathematical programming operations. A concise introduction to mathematical logic textbook thirdedition typeset and layout. Best of all, they are entirely free to find, use and download, so. Introduction to mathematical programming by winston and venkataramanan. Unlike static pdf student solutions manual for winstons introduction to mathematical programming. Its easier to figure out tough problems faster using chegg study.

Necessary to begin using mathematical programming as a tool for managerial applications and beyond, this empowering guide helps students learn to recognize when a mathematical model can be useful and helps them develop an appreciation and understanding of the mathematics. Volume one isbn 0534359647 includes chapters 1 through 10, 11, and 14 of. Its a clean, modern language, and it comes with many of the mathematical structures that we will. Introduction to mathematical programming electrical. Applications and algorithms 4th edition solution manuals or printed answer keys, our experts. This book is not designed to be a complete textbook or.

Applications discussed are the longest path problem, which is similar to the determination of earliest times in the cpm model. Introduction to mathematical programming solution manual. Mathematical programming has been extensively used to solve optimization models associated to the decisionmaking problems emerging at the different hierarchical decision levels. Professor devlins way of putting out lots of exercises and going through them meticulously afterwards is as challenging as it is rewarding. Buy introduction to mathematical programming on free shipping on qualified orders.

Solutions to the even numbered problems are available from the author in a pdf file. An introduction to linear programming williams college. Recitations introduction to mathematical programming. Introduction to mathematical programming 2nd edition pdf. Applied mathematical programming using algebraic systems by bruce a. Linear programming is used to successfully model numerous real world situations, ranging. Winston, munirpallam venkataramanan and a great selection of related books, art and collectibles available now at.

Mathematical thinking is not the same as doing mathematics at. Introduction to applied mathematics introduction to mathematics there is a growing sense of excitement and anticipation as teachers, students and parents discover the wonder of mathematics through applications. If youre looking for a free download links of matlab. Applications and algorithms, volume 1 with cdrom and infotrac by wayne l. Winston published 1990 computer science introduction to mathematical programming. Download free ebooks at mathematics for computer scientists 4 contents contents introduction 5 1 numbers 6 2 e statement calculus and logic 20 3 mathematical induction 35 4 sets 39. It is a little like programming, it takes time to understand a lot of. So if you need to download pdf introduction to mathematical programming. Mathematical programming the mathematical programming addin constructs models that can be solved using the solver addin or one of the solution addins provided in the collection. Empowering users with the knowledge necessary to begin using mathematical programming as a tool for managerial applications and beyond, this practical guide shows when a.

A mathematical introduction to robotic manipulation richard m. Evans department of mathematics university of california, berkeley. The author version from june 2009 corrections included. Winston, munirpallam venkataramanan this introduction to mathematical programming. So this is an optimization book, not a computer programming book. Freely browse and use ocw materials at your own pace. But it is an excellent introduction to the subject of mathematical programming, carefully written and profusely illustrated with fully worked out examples. There are approxi introduction to mathematical programming oper mately 1,500 problems, grouped by level of difficulty. Applications and algorithms djvu, pdf, epub, doc, txt formats. Dynamic programming requires an introduction to recursion. The book is aimed at students of mathematics, computer science, and linguistics. Introduction to operations research deterministic models. The book has a strong computer orientation and emphasizes modelformulation and modelbuilding skills.

A mathematical introduction to robotic manipulation. An introduction to linear, nonlinear, largescale, stochastic programming. Introduction to mathematical programming 4th edition. Since mathematical programming is only a tool of the broad discipline known as management science. This leads to a brief excursion through the towers of hanoi, fibonacci numbers, and the binomial expansion. In order to navigate out of this carousel please use your heading shortcut key to navigate to the next or previous heading. How to download introduction to mathematical programming 2nd edition pdf. Mathematics 9 is a rigorous, academic mathematics curriculum. Mathematical programming an overview sciencedirect topics.

In general, these optimization models are developed to be used for comprehensive decisionmaking frameworks, and they are adjustable enough to solve. To make the book available online, most chapters have been retypeset. Introduction to mathematical programming, russell c. An excellent introductory course to mathematical thinking or a companion course to follow while shuffling through your first book about mathematical proofs. Winston, in that case you come on to the loyal site. An applied approach 227 6 sensitivity analysis and duality 262 7 transportation, assignment, and transshipment problems 360 8 network models 4 9 integer programming 475.

Find materials for this course in the pages linked along the left. Pdf decoding errorcorrectiong codes by methods of mathematical optimization, most importantly linear programming, has become an. New warrelated projects demanded attention and spread resources thin. If youre looking for a free download links of introduction to mathematical programming 2nd edition pdf, epub, docx and torrent then this site is not for you. We intend this book as an introduction both to mathematical programming and to ampl. Transportation, assignment, and transshipment problems 8. Appendix a contains a brief summary of some of the mathematical language that is assumed from such a course.

Applied mathematical programming using algebraic systems by. One of the best features of the book is the large number of problems following each chapter and the solutions to these problems given at the end of the book. Pdf this book consists of the preliminaries of mathematical programming, convex sets, topics of linear programming, integer linear. Applications and algorithms, volume 1 with cdrom and infotrac from. The mathematical programming addin constructs models that can be solved using the. Winston, 9780534359645, available at book depository with free delivery.

Studying logic programming is a good introduction to mathematical logic, because the logic behind logic programming is simple, and allows results. Mathematical programming, a branch of operations research, is perhaps the most efficient technique in making optimal decisions. March 31, 2007 mathematics department brown university 151 thayer street providence, ri 02912 abstract we describe linear programming, an important generalization of linear algebra. Introduction to mathematical programming, with an emphasis on fundamental mathematical concepts used in optimization, classical optimization theory and applications of optimization in engineering. Mathematical programming, linear programming and nonlinear, industrial engineering, operations research, optimization etc. It has a very wide application in the analysis of management problems, in business and industry, in economic studies, in military problems and in many other fields of our present day activities.

Focus on convex analysis convex sets, separation theorems, convex functions, optimality conditions. The jensen lpip solver solves linear or integer programming problems. The word programming does not refer to computer programming but originally referred to the preparation of a schedule of activities. Learn how to think the way mathematicians do a powerful cognitive process developed over thousands of years. A variety of integer programming models is then discussed, and the chapter concludes with a branchandbound approach to the traveling salesman problem. Other material such as the dictionary notation was adapted. Mathematica programming an advanced introduction is a moderately paced practical tutorial for mathematica programming language. Applications discussed are the longest path problem, which is similar to the determination of earliest times in the cpm model, the fixed cost transportation problem, and the cargo loading problem.

Jan 01, 1991 a subset of winstons bestselling operations research, introduction to mathematical programming focusing on deterministic models, this book is designed for the first half of an operations research sequence. Evaluating mathematical programming techniques proceedings of a conference held at the national bureau of standards, boulder, colorado, january 56, 1981, john m. Lecture notes introduction to mathematical programming. It is this spectrum of techniques and their effective implementation in practice that are considered in this book. The notes were meant to provide a succint summary of the material, most of which was loosely based on the book winstonvenkataramanan. As a vehicle, i use the programming language python.

An introduction to mathematical optimal control theory. Learn introduction to mathematical thinking from stanford university. Stochastic programming, robust programming, combinatorial optimization, infinitedimensional optimization, metaheuristics, constraint satisfaction, constraint programming, disjunctive programming, dynamic programming, multiobjective optimization, major subfields wikipedia mathematical optimization or mathematical programming. Pdf introduction to mathematical programmingbased error. This course is an introduction to linear optimization and its extensions emphasizing the underlying mathematical structures, geometrical ideas, algorithms and solutions of practical problems. Mathematical programming refers to both linear and nonlinear optimization. Likewise, the application of ecological and evolutionarytheory often requires a high degree of mathematical competence. An introduction to logic programming through prolog. Thats the kind of thinking that this book promotes. Introduction to mathematical programming applications and.

628 654 1101 1017 1270 1577 1551 839 990 402 1074 706 1625 975 1026 1048 1519 240 1546 7 512 516 522 800 230 989 1336 777 16 123 1391 676 1072 968 1011 1341